## Deployment

Quick note for new folks: pagination on the Larkspur public REST API is cursor-based, and the cursor signing key is baked in at deploy time — so yes, rotating it invalidates every in-flight cursor. Plan rollouts accordingly (we do them Tuesday mornings when traffic is quiet). The deploy script reads page-size limits, cursor TTL, and signing settings from one config file and refuses to start if anything's missing. Here's what we currently ship to production.

deployment values, yadup-kadug:
[sorys]
port = 5672
team = noveth
host = sorys.orvexcorp.example
region = south-4
access_code = ac_deddc1
timeout_ms = 1500

## Ownership

The clock-skew monitor for the Quarrylight build farm lives in this repo. Build agents occasionally drift more than the 250ms tolerance, which breaks artifact timestamp ordering and causes the Slatebird scheduler to mark runs as flaky. If support sees skew alerts, first check the NTP sidecar logs, then escalate rather than restarting agents manually — restarts mask the drift without fixing it. Questions about the monitor, its thresholds, or the escalation path go to the component owner listed below.

account owner for kagag-yahap: Novath Quenok

Action item (P2): Quillport template renderer exceeded its p99 budget during the Harrowgate launch due to uncached nested partials. Fix: enable partial memoization by default and add a compile-time depth warning. Owner: rendering team. Verify with the synthetic load suite before close. Benchmark methodology and acceptance thresholds are documented on the page below.

operations page: https://jenkins.zemvarcloud.local/job/merge_requests/repo/build/73930b4b30f0a8ed

Runbook: Formula Sandbox Isolation (Calcwright)

When a tenant submits a custom formula, the evaluator must run inside the Quarrel sandbox with the syscall filter enabled. Never execute user expressions in the main worker pool, even for "trusted" tenants — the Brindlemoor incident showed how quickly that assumption breaks. Each sandbox gets a read-only snapshot of the reference tables and a 200ms CPU budget. Audit results land in the evaluation ledger, which the sandbox writes to directly. The ledger lives on the following database.

warehouse DSN: mssql://druius_svc:aJ@db-b2f3.xolmarhq.local:5432/soreth